关闭

AP计算机科学A学什么?

AP计算机科学

AP计算机科学A学什么?第一单元学习计算机编程概念,第二单元学习深入的计算机编程概念,第三单元学习超类/子类与实例变量,第四单元学习字符串类,第五单元学习数组,第六单元学习搜索和排序。

满意回答
时间:2022-01-19 18:36:34
  • 课程顾问-Lea
    课程顾问-Lea
    立即咨询

      AP计算机科学A学什么?第一单元学习计算机编程概念,第二单元学习深入的计算机编程概念,第三单元学习超类/子类与实例变量,第四单元学习字符串类,第五单元学习数组,第六单元学习搜索和排序。

    AP计算机科学A学什么?

      第一单元:本单元主要学习计算机编程概念,如原始数据类型、如何使用算术数据编写基本程序、在数字基之间转换以及使用数学开始编程,学习数学运算符编写程序,什么是关系运算符以及如何用它们编程,使用逻辑运算符的真值表,什么是运算符优先级以及如何用它编程,以及扫描仪输入。

      第二单元:本单元主要学习深入的计算机编程概念,包括决策语句以及如何用它们编程,迭代以及如何使用它编写程序,以及公共和私有定义之间的区别,学习理解头、方法重载、变量范围、参数引用与原语,以及如何使用类和数据文件进行编程。

      第三单元:本单元主要学习超类/子类与实例变量,使用子构造函数中的超调用、方法重写以及继承方法和变量,学习创建一个超级/子类程序,以及使用多态性、抽象类和接口(实现)。

      第四单元:本单元主要学习字符串类,诸如将字符串与“+”组合、比较字符串以及编写字符串方法等技能。

      第五单元:本单元主要学习数组,包括一维和二维数组,学习如何遍历数组,以及如何在数组中添加、删除和插入,还学习并行数组、数组列表方法和编写2D数组程序。

      第六单元:本单元主要学习搜索和排序,学习执行顺序搜索和二分搜索法,学习编程数字搜索、递归、执行选择、插入、冒泡和合并排序,以及选择排序的编码。

Alevel课程辅导IB课程辅导AP课程培训IGCSE补课英语语言培训入学考试

添加微信(备注官网)申请试听,享专属套餐优惠!

立即咨询
考而思·惟世客服微信

vx:KesWish

免费获得学习规划方案

已有 2563 位留学生获得学习规划方案

马上领取规划

*已对您的信息加密,保障信息安全。

最新活动

最新活动 最新活动

复制成功

微信号: Keswish

备注“官网”享专属套餐优惠!